Who qualifies for weight loss medication

Our EU-licensed doctors follow clinical guidelines to determine if GLP-1 medications like Semaglutide (Wegovy) or Tirzepatide (Mounjaro) are appropriate for you. Generally, the doctor looks for:

  • A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 kg/m² or greater (obesity).
  • A BMI of 27 kg/m² or greater (overweight) with at least one weight-related comorbidity (e.g., type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ure, high cholesterol, sleep apnoea).
  • No history of certain medical conditions, including person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or Multiple Endocrine Ne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2).
  • Not pregnant, breastfeeding, or planning to become pregnant.

During your online consultation, you'll provide your full medical history, and the doctor will assess all factors to ensure your safety and the treatment's effectiveness.

What weight loss medication actually does (and doesn't do)

Medications like Semaglutide (Wegovy/Ozempic) and Tirzepatide (Mounjaro) are GLP-1 receptor agonists (and GIP for Tirzepatide). They work by mimicking natural hormones in your body, which helps to:

  • Reduce appetite: You feel fuller for longer and experience fewer cravings.
  • Slow gastric emptying: Food stays in your stomach longer, contributing to increased satiety.
  • Improve blood sugar control: Beneficial for those with or at risk of type 2 diabetes.

These medications are powerful tools for weight management, but they are not magic pills. They are most effective when combined with lifestyle changes, including a balanced diet and regular physical activity. Weight loss is gradual and varies between individuals, typically showing significant results over several months of consistent use. They do not replace healthy habits; they support them.

Side effects and when to stop

Like all medications, GLP-1s can cause side effects. The most common ones are gastrointestinal and tend to be mild to moderate, often improving over time as your body adjusts. These include:

  • Nausea
  • Diarrhoea or constipation
  • Vomiting
  • Abdominal pain

It's crucial to discuss any persistent or severe side effects with your doctor. You should seek immediate medical attention if you experience signs of a serious allergic reaction, pancreatitis, gallbladder problems, or severe abdominal pain.
